Output 149db20863b056b5aa4b9f2307ba85cef3de8e3c4b8ee6ade74a960f025836a0:60

value
18026
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8029536d70380fc568a8522d75c7d35043ff307a0a4dd2142e82fc3eb3e3a6fb
address
bc1psq54xmts8q8u269g2gkht37n2ppl7vr6pfxay9pwst7ravlr5mas6hnl6j
transaction
149db20863b056b5aa4b9f2307ba85cef3de8e3c4b8ee6ade74a960f025836a0
spent
true